Blame examples/extract.sh
|
Packit |
98cdb6 |
#! /bin/sh
|
|
Packit |
98cdb6 |
# extract - extract C source files from GTK Tutorial
|
|
Packit |
98cdb6 |
# Copyright (C) Tony Gale 1998
|
|
Packit |
98cdb6 |
# Contact: gale@gtk.org
|
|
Packit |
98cdb6 |
#
|
|
Packit |
98cdb6 |
# extract.awk command Switches:
|
|
Packit |
98cdb6 |
# -c : Just do checking rather than output files
|
|
Packit |
98cdb6 |
# -f <filename> : Extract a specific file
|
|
Packit |
98cdb6 |
# -d : Extract files to current directory
|
|
Packit |
98cdb6 |
|
|
Packit |
98cdb6 |
TUTORIAL=../docs/tutorial/gtk-tut.sgml
|
|
Packit |
98cdb6 |
|
|
Packit |
98cdb6 |
if [ -x /usr/bin/gawk ]; then
|
|
Packit |
98cdb6 |
gawk -f extract.awk $TUTORIAL $1 $2 $3 $4 $5
|
|
Packit |
98cdb6 |
else
|
|
Packit |
98cdb6 |
if [ -x /usr/bin/nawk ]; then
|
|
Packit |
98cdb6 |
nawk -f extract.awk $TUTORIAL $1 $2 $3 $4 $5
|
|
Packit |
98cdb6 |
else
|
|
Packit |
98cdb6 |
if [ -x /usr/bin/awk ]; then
|
|
Packit |
98cdb6 |
awk -f extract.awk $TUTORIAL $1 $2 $3 $4 $5
|
|
Packit |
98cdb6 |
else
|
|
Packit |
98cdb6 |
if [ -x /bin/awk ]; then
|
|
Packit |
98cdb6 |
awk -f extract.awk $TUTORIAL $1 $2 $3 $4 $5
|
|
Packit |
98cdb6 |
else
|
|
Packit |
98cdb6 |
echo "Can't find awk... please edit extract.sh by hand"
|
|
Packit |
98cdb6 |
fi
|
|
Packit |
98cdb6 |
fi
|
|
Packit |
98cdb6 |
fi
|
|
Packit |
98cdb6 |
fi
|
|
Packit |
98cdb6 |
|